Sewing with Liberty Tana Lawn is like stitching wi Sewing with Liberty Tana Lawn is like stitching with poetry 💐—soft, lightweight, and full of charm. Whether you're making mini pouches, quilt blocks, or heirloom gifts, a few thoughtful tips can help you get perfect results every time.Here are my top tips for working with Liberty fabric:
🪡 Use a fine needle (70/10) for smooth stitching
✂️ Lightweight interfacing adds structure without bulk
🧵 Save every scrap—they’re magic in small projects like my Mini Treat Pouch or Classic Wreath Ornaments
🌸 Perfect for English Paper Piecing, FPP, and delicate seamsWant the full breakdown?
